What is a $200 an hour job?

A "$200 An Hour" job refers to a profession or freelance role where individuals earn $200 per hour for their work. These jobs are typically found in specialized fields such as law, consulting, medicine, high-level finance, or skilled freelancing. Earning this rate usually requires expertise, experience, and a strong network of clients or employers willing to pay a premium for high-quality service. Some careers, like top-tier lawyers, business consultants, or IT specialists, can command these rates regularly. Others may achieve this level through contract work, self-employment, or niche expertise.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the $200 an hour position, and why are they important?

To earn $200 an hour, professionals generally need deep expertise, advanced degrees, and significant experience in highly specialized fields such as law, medicine, consulting, or senior-level technical roles. Mastery of industry-specific tools and credentials—such as advanced medical board certifications, bar membership for attorneys, or certifications in specialized IT systems—is typically required. Standout professionals also possess strong client management, communication, and problem-solving skills. These qualities ensure superior service delivery and justifiable premium rates in demanding, high-stakes environments.

What types of professionals typically earn $200 an hour, and what are their main responsibilities?

Professionals earning $200 an hour are typically found in fields such as experienced attorneys, medical specialists, highly sought-after consultants, or executive freelancers with rare technical expertise. Their main responsibilities often include high-level problem solving, direct client advisement, and delivery of specialized services that require advanced knowledge and proven success. These roles may involve working solo or in small expert teams, often serving executive clients or organizations facing complex challenges. Because of the high level of trust and expertise required, these professionals frequently manage their own schedules, client relationships, and service outcomes, which allows for both flexibility and significant responsibility.
